Суббота , 9 Декабрь 2023

РЕШЕНИЕ: Ошибка установки .NET Framework 3.5 на Windows 10

Статья представляет собой пошаговое решение ошибки установки .NET Framework 3.5 на Windows 10. Решение подходит для ошибок: 0x8024401С, 0x800F081F, 0x800F0950 (и, возможно, других, связанных с ошибкой установки .NET Framework 3.5)

Довольно часто, при установке .NET Framework 3.5 на Windows 10, возникает ошибка: «Не удалось установить следующий компонент: .NET Framework 3.5 (включает .NET 2.0 и 3.0)»

Ниже представлено пошаговое решение данной проблемы. 

Решение:

1. После возникновения ошибки: «Не удалось установить следующий компонент: .NET Framework 3.5 (включает .NET 2.0 и 3.0)» нажмите в окне Закрыть (Рис.1). 

Рис.1

.

2. Нажмите клавиши Win + R (либо: Пуск, затем откройте там папку Служебные — Windows и выберите в ней Выполнить). В открывшемся окне в поле для ввода введите: regedit и нажмите ОК (Рис.2).

Рис.2

.

3. В окне Редактор реестра перейдите к разделу (это можно сделать через левую часть окна): HKEY_LOCAL_MACHINE\SOFTWARE\Policies\Microsoft\Windows\WindowsUpdate\AU (прим. можете скопировать отсюда и вставить в соответствующее поле в Редакторе реестра., либо найти нужную директорию через дерево папок в левой части окна Редактора реестра), затем сделайте двойной клик по параметру UseWUServer (Рис.3).

Рис.3

.

4. В открывшемся окне Именение параметра DWORD (32 бита) установите в поле Значение 0 (прим. вместо 1) и нажмите ОК (Рис.4).

Рис.4

.

5. Убедитесь, что значение параметра с именем UseWUServer изменилось на 0, после чего перезагрузите компьютер (Рис.5).

Рис.5

.

6. После перезагрузки компьютера, запустите установку .NET Framework 3.5, убедитесь, что установка прошла успешно и нажмите Закрыть (Рис.6).

Рис.6

.

7. После успешной установки .NET Framework 3.5, руководствуясь вышеописанным, установите значение 1 для параметра с именем UseWUServer, нажмите ОК и перезагрузите компьютер (Рис.7).

Рис.7

.

Установка .NET Framework 3.5 завершена!

.

3 комментария

  1. Спасибо!
    Все перепробовал, этот способ сработал!

  2. А у меня нету строки UseWUServer. Что делать?

    • У меня тоже не было строки UseWUServer, я взял тонкий маркер и вписал на экране все как на скриншоте в статье. Потом перезагрузил компьютер, но .NET Framework так и не хотел устанавливаться. Тогда я решил, что редактор реестра не воспринимает надписи на мониторе, тогда я шилом нацарапал необходимые параметры и залил черными чернилами (что бы уже навярняка компьютер через монитор получил запись в реестре). После перезагрузки .NET Framework опять не хотел устанавливаться, к тому же пришлось покупать новый монитор (царапины на экране немного мешали). Тогда я полностью разочаровавшись в своих умственных способностях, решил попробовать самый последний (маловероятный) возможный вариант, нажал правой кнопкой мыши в нужном разделе реестра и создал параметр DWORD (32 бита) UseWUServer со значением 0. И о чудо, после ребута .NET Framework 3,5 установился!

Добавить комментарий для Иван Отменить ответ

Войти с помощью: 

Ваш адрес email не будет опубликован. Обязательные поля помечены *